Target Kicks Off Back-to-School and Back-to-College with Style at the Center, Newness and More Partnerships, All at Incredible Value

AI Summary

Target announces an expansive back-to-school and college assortment, featuring LoveShackFancy x Target and several exclusive partners like Overtime, Hollister, and Owala. More than half of the items are new this year, with many under $25 and promotions through Target Circle. The launches could lift foot traffic and discretionary sales ahead of the school season.

Key Facts

  • LoveShackFancy x Target collab debuts July 5 for limited time. Most items under $55.
  • Overtime, Hollister, Owala, and Poppi expand exclusive back-to-school offerings at Target. Prices start from $24.99 and vary by item.
  • Target Circle Deal Days run through June 26 with up to 45% off; teachers/students get 20% off.
  • Over 50% of this year's assortment is new, with thousands of exclusive items across categories.
